Removing the doors on a 2026 Jeep Wrangler is part of what makes the Wrangler such an iconic open-air vehicle. Whether you’re heading out on a summer trail ride or just want that classic Jeep feel, the process is straightforward when done correctly. Just remember to check local driving laws before heading out without doors or mirrors.

Before you begin, park the vehicle on a level surface, turn it off, and lower the windows. This helps prevent glass damage and makes the doors easier to handle. Having a friend nearby is helpful, as Wrangler doors are solid and heavier than they look.

How to Remove the Doors

  1. Disconnect the wiring harness located near the door hinges. This controls power windows, locks, and mirrors.
  2. If equipped, unclip the door check strap to prevent resistance while lifting.
  3. Remove the hinge bolts using the factory tool kit or a socket wrench. Keep bolts somewhere safe.
  4. Open the door slightly and lift straight up to clear the hinge pins.
  5. Carry the door away carefully and store it upright on a padded surface to avoid scratches.

Repeat these steps for each door. Front doors are typically heavier than rear doors, so take your time.

Driving door-free changes visibility and airflow, so adjust mirrors if needed and secure all loose items inside the cabin before driving.

How to Reinstall the Doors

  1. Position the door so the hinge sleeves line up with the hinge pins on the body.
  2. Lower the door straight down until it seats fully on the hinges.
  3. Reinstall and tighten the hinge bolts snugly (do not overtighten).
  4. Reattach the door check strap.
  5. Reconnect the wiring harness and ensure it clicks securely.
  6. Test window, lock, and mirror functions before driving.

After reinstalling, open and close each door to confirm proper alignment and smooth operation.
